Стресс-тест сети с Low Orbit Ion Cannon (LOIC)

Что такое Low Orbit Ion Cannon (LOIC)

Low Orbit Ion Cannon (LOIC) — это инструмент стресс-теста сети, это значит, что он создан для проверки, как много трафика цель может обработать. Чтобы основываясь на этих данных сделать оценку запаса мощности ресурсов. Эта программа вдохновила создание других подобных программ, у неё существует множество клонов, некоторые из которых позволяют проводить стресс-тест прямо из браузера.

Эта программа с успехом использовалась группой Anonymous, для облегчения их DDoS атак против нескольких веб-сайтов, в том числе некоторых очень известных общественных организаций. Противники запрета этой программы указывают, что то, что она делает, аналогично заходу на веб-сайт несколько тысяч раз; тем не менее, некоторые американские правоохранительные группы расценивают использование LOIC как нарушение компьютерной безопасности и мошенническое действие.

Установка Low Orbit Ion Cannon (LOIC) на Windows

Для пользователей Windows всё совсем просто — зайдите на сайт и скачайте архив. Распакуйте из архива один единственный файл и запустите его. Всё готово!

07

Установка Low Orbit Ion Cannon (LOIC) на Linux

Установить LOIC можно на любой Linux, ниже, в качестве примера, выбрана установка на Kali Linux.

Для установки LOIC откройте окно терминала и наберите там:

apt-get update
aptitude install git-core monodevelop
apt-get install mono-gmcs

01

Если вы, как и я, устанавливаете на Kali Linux, то следующий шаг пропускаете. Если же у вас Ubuntu, Linux Mint (возможно нужно и для Debian), то выполните следующую команду:

sudo apt-get install mono-complete

Когда всё завершилось, идём в каталог рабочего стола, используя

cd ./Desktop

и создаём там папку с названием loic, используя следующую команду:

mkdir loic

02

Переходим туда, используя

cd ./loic 

и печатаем там следующую команду:

wget https://raw.githubusercontent.com/nicolargo/loicinstaller/master/loic.sh

03

Далее дадим разрешения файлу скрипта на исполнение:

chmod 777 loic.sh

Ну и последним шагом запустим скрипт следующей командой:

./loic.sh install

Если вы не видите от скрипта каких-либо сообщений об ошибках, значит вы уже готовы обновить loic. Чтобы сделать это, выполните следующую команду:

./loic.sh update

Ну и совсем уже последнее, запускаем LOIC. Вы можете это сделать следующей командой:

./loic.sh run

04

05

Кстати, помните, что на Windows мы быстрее получили программу (просто скачали файл)? А зато на Linux версия программы новее!

Стресс-тест сети с Low Orbit Ion Cannon (LOIC)

Использование LOIC простое как пробка. Вы можете выбрать ручной или IRC режим. Для следующего примера мы выберем ручной режим. Введите URL или IP адрес. Мы введём адрес сайта. Нажмите Lock on. Нужно выбрать метод атаки: TCP, UDP или HTTP. Мы выберем HTTP. Остальные настройки можно не менять. Когда всё готово, запустите атаку кнопкой IMMA CHARGIN MAH LAZER. LOIC покажет процесс атаки. Нажмите на кнопку Stop Flooding для остановки атаки:

06

п.с. я изучил логи сервера, заметна значительная разница между версиями для Windows и Linux. Надо думать, что там не только добавили свистоперделки вроде IRC режима, но и изменили алгоритмы самих атак. Также интересна новая опция по подстановки случайных значений в качестве поддерикторий.   

11 комментариев

  1. По содержанию видно, что это вроде мануала для новичков. Ну тогда и вопросы соответствующие:

    Как я понимаю, глушить жертву через прокси нельзя, т.к. проксе и достанется если не всё, то всё-равно что-то?

    Ну а тогда как работать без прокси? Ведь пропалят IP и…  

    Сколько времени нужно, чтобы завалить жертву ( если не намертво, то временно) и за кокое время можно пыхнуть с этим делом?

    1. Спасибо за разъяснение. Извините, если что набуровил тут.

      Я в Linux новичек, пробую пока. Вот даже по вашей инструкции с 2 раз не смог установить LOIC. Первый раз снёс. заново. И всё вроде так делал, но в в самом конце стали ошибки и предупреждения выскакивать. В итоге так и не запустилась программа. Гуглил по ошибкам — ничего толком не понял.. 

       

       

      1. Кто не спрашивает, тот ничему и не научится. Я и сам в процессе обучения.

        Что касается проблемы с установкой, то да, эта ошибка есть. В том числе она появляется и на Mint. Проблема решается выполнением команды

        sudo apt-get install mono-complete

        Там много каких пакетов поустанавливается, но LOIC после этого работает — только что проверил. Завтра подправлю статью. Спасибо, что обратили внимание на эту проблему! 

  2. Если есть желание проверьте на сайте http://free-linux.ru/ , сайт мой.
    Программа была в популярности лет так 5-7 назад, сейчас она разве что чуть сильнее зажатой отвертки F5.

    1. Добрый день. благодарю за подробную инструкцию.
      Возникает ошибка при установке, loic.sh на Kali linux 2.0, следующего содержания «MonoDevelop Build Tool. Project file not found.»
      Mono-complete установлен. Если кто сталкивался с подобным, буду благодарен за помощь.

  3. помогите! aptitude install git-core monodevelop , пишет bash: aptitude:command not found, а если в ручную все устанавливать , то когда дохожу до пункта ./loic.sh install, то пишет usr/bin/git
    monodevelop build tool
    operation no fond

Оставить ответ

Ваш адрес email не будет опубликован. Обязательные поля помечены *